Hookups and Settings "4:3 Letter Box": For standard TVs. Displays "wide screen" pictures with bands on the upper and lower sections of the screen. "4:3 Pan Scan": For standard TVs. Automatically displays "wide screen" pictures on the entire screen and cuts off the sections that do not fit. "16:9": For wide-screen TVs or standard TVs with a wide screen mode. Finish Dolby Digital D-PCM Dolby Digital 15 Select the type of Dolby Digital signal you want to send to your amplifier (receiver). If your AV amplifier (receiver) has a Dolby Digital decoder, select "Dolby Digital." Otherwise, select "D-PCM." 16 Press ENTER. The setup display for selecting the type of DTS signal appears. No Disc Easy Setup 10:10 AM DTS On Off 17 Select whether or not you want to send a DTS signal to your amplifier (receiver), and press ENTER. If your AV amplifier (receiver) has a DTS decoder, select "On." Otherwise, select "Off." Checking the cable box/satellite receiver control setting 1 Turn on the recorder and the cable box/ satellite receiver. 2 Point the recorder's remote at the recorder (not at the cable box/satellite receiver). 3 Press CH +/- and check that the channel changes on the cable box/satellite receiver window. 4 Press the number buttons and check that the channel changes on the cable box/ satellite receiver window. If you cannot get the recorder to control your cable box/satellite receiver Check the settings at "Set Top Box Control" in "Features" setup (page 105). Check the connection and place the set top box controller near the cable box/satellite receiver (page 12). ,continued 25
